Freddy Peralta Trade Talks Set to Restart as Top Contenders Circle

Milwaukee is signaling a high bar for bidders by seeking a major‑league‑ready starter in any return.

Overview

  • Talks are expected to resume in earnest, according to reporting by The Athletic on Monday.
  • Interest spans the Yankees, Mets, Dodgers, Braves and Red Sox, with lower‑revenue clubs also viewed as viable due to Peralta’s salary.
  • The Brewers’ price remains steep, with reports indicating a requirement for a big‑league‑ready starting pitcher in packages.
  • Peralta is coming off a 17–6 season with a 2.70 ERA and 204 strikeouts and is under control for 2026 at about $8 million before free agency.
  • The Yankees are also engaged on Edward Cabrera with Miami as a multi‑year control alternative to a one‑year Peralta acquisition.
